Chapter 61: Brotherly Conflict


Mu Hongtu scolded angrily, “Mu Lantu, what are you pretending to be confused about? If it weren’t for you, why would your sister-in-law be demanding a divorce from me? Do you have a grudge against me or something? Are you determined to ruin my family? Get back here immediately!”

Xu Huazhang’s face darkened. What kind of brother is this?

“Baby, is he really your biological brother?”

Mu Lantu replied calmly, “Biologically, yes.”

“Are you going back?” Xu Huazhang gently kissed his lips, worried about his mood.

Mu Lantu snorted lightly. “Just because he told me to go back, I will? I’d have no dignity then. Even if I do go back, it won’t be until ten days or half a month later.”

Ding-dong.

A WeChat message.

Mu Lantu opened it. It was from a high school classmate, Fang Dongxue, whom he had reconnected with when buying a car.

Why would she message him? Though they’d added each other on WeChat, they had never actually contacted one another.

“Baby, who is it?” Xu Huazhang considered himself a gentleman, keeping his eyes to himself, though he watched Mu Lantu’s subtle expressions out of the corner of his eye.

Mu Lantu said, “Fang Dongxue.”

Xu Huazhang snorted. He remembered her—this was the girl who had eagerly asked to add Lantu on WeChat.

Mu Lantu read the message, and his handsome face turned grim.

[Fang Dongxue]: Old classmate, I have something to tell you. Is your sister-in-law named Yang Xiurong? Does she work at Hongke Restaurant in Anfeng? My sister works there too. I just happened to hear her mention that your sister-in-law was saying you’ve been kept by someone. You know what I mean, right? We’re old classmates. I couldn’t let you be in the dark. I’ve thought about it for a while, and I felt I had to tell you. I hope you don’t take it the wrong way and think I’m being nosy.

[Mu Lantu]: Not at all. Thank you for telling me. When I get back to Qingning, I’ll treat you and your husband to a meal.

[Fang Dongxue]: No need for a meal. I’m just glad you don’t mind. I believe in you! And don’t worry, I’m not the gossiping type—I won’t even tell my husband.

“What’s wrong?” Xu Huazhang could tell something was off.

Mu Lantu said coldly, “I’m going back to Qingning tomorrow.”

Xu Huazhang didn’t feel comfortable letting him go alone and said firmly, “I’m going with you.”

Mu Lantu said, “Book the earliest flight for tomorrow.”

By around eleven, the group of four arrived in Anfeng.

After having lunch in the county town, Mu Lantu called Mu Hongtu.

“I’m at Mom and Dad’s supermarket right now. If you want to talk, come now. I might not be free later.”

Before Mu Hongtu could say anything, he hung up.

Mu Lantu brought two takeout meals to Mu Zhenguo and He Cuifang and arrived at the supermarket.

Both parents were there and startled to see them.

“Lantu, you… you all came back?”

Mu Zhenguo and He Cuifang looked haggard, clearly worn out. He Cuifang looked like she had aged five years.

“We just felt like coming back.” Mu Lantu smiled and handed them the food. “Dad, Mom, eat first. We’ll talk after you’re done. We’ve already eaten.”

He Cuifang took the bag and touched it—still warm. Inside was one box of rice, one of freshly cooked dishes—two meat, one veggie—and a sealed cup of mung bean soup.

Tears welled up in her eyes. She had raised both sons the same way. Why was one so considerate, and the other so…

“Zhenguo, go borrow a few stools from the noodle shop next door.”

Mu Zhenguo hesitated. “They’re still doing business. How can I borrow them?”

Mu Lantu said, “No need, Mom. We’re fine standing.”

He and the others stood under a tree by the roadside. The wind was blowing and it wasn’t hot.

Xu Huazhang bought two ice creams—vanilla chocolate and milk chocolate—and let Mu Lantu pick first.

He chose the milk chocolate.

Mu Zhenguo and He Cuifang didn’t want them waiting too long and ate quickly.

Soon after, Mu Hongtu drove over with a face like someone here to collect a debt—as if Mu Lantu owed him five million.

“Shall we talk at my house?”

Mu Zhenguo’s heart sank. As expected, his oldest had called Lantu. Who knew what he had said to make him come back?

Mu Lantu said, “No need. I’ve arranged a place.”

There were no cafés or teahouses suitable for discussions in this county. So Mu Lantu paid a nearby breakfast shop owner 100 yuan to use the space for up to two hours.

The shop only served breakfast, so there were no customers at this hour. The owner happily took his phone and went for a stroll, telling Mu Lantu to just lock up when they left. The place had nothing valuable, and it was broad daylight, so no worries about theft.

“This is a breakfast shop. There’s no lunch here,” Mu Hongtu said, thinking Mu Lantu didn’t know.

Xu Huazhang pulled out two chairs for the parents.

They realized the matter between their sons was beyond their control and sat silently.

Mu Lantu said, “We’ve eaten. Let’s finish this quickly so we can go our separate ways.”

Mu Hongtu felt uncomfortable. They’d eaten, but he was still hungry.

That was deliberate. Mu Lantu had no intention of sitting at the same table with him. Otherwise, he could’ve just booked a private room at a hotel, which would have had a better environment.

Xu Huazhang squeezed Mu Lantu’s shoulder, and they both sat down.

Mu Hongtu had no choice but to sit as well.

Looking at Xu Huazhang, he said to Mu Lantu, “Maybe you should ask your friend to step outside?”

Mu Lantu tapped the table. “There’s nothing I need to hide from him. Just say what you came here to say.”

Mu Hongtu tried to pretend Xu Huazhang didn’t exist.

“Yesterday, on the phone, I told you about your sister-in-law wanting a divorce.”

Mu Lantu remained composed. “So? That’s between the two of you. Isn’t it inappropriate for me to interfere? Did you really need me to come back just for that?”

Ge Tao came in with four bottles of cold drinks—only four.

Xu Huazhang handed one to each person—except Mu Hongtu.

Mu Hongtu wasn’t thirsty, but seeing he didn’t get one made his mouth feel dry. He licked his lips unconsciously.

Could he blame Ge Tao? No. They had no connection. Why should he be treated to a drink?

Xu Huazhang opened a mango milk drink and passed it to Mu Lantu.

Mu Hongtu averted his eyes. “Since you insist on playing dumb, I’ll say it straight. You bought cars and watches for Zhenzhen and Wangjun, but didn’t buy anything for me or your sister-in-law. She’s upset—says you’re ignoring the two of us. That’s why she wants a divorce.”

Mu Lantu replied without hesitation, “Big brother, you’re good at playing dumb too. Why didn’t I buy you anything? You really don’t know?”

Mu Hongtu’s brows shot up in anger. “You mean you deliberately didn’t buy us anything?”

Mu Lantu answered bluntly, “I’m not stupid. If someone slaps me in the face, why would I spend money on them? Not only did I buy cars and watches for others, when Xiao Xing grows up, I even plan to buy him a house.”

Mu Hongtu exploded, “Mu Lantu, do you even respect me as your elder brother?!”

“And did you ever treat me like your younger brother?” Mu Lantu put down his drink and punched him in the face. “When your wife said I was being kept by someone, did you defend me even once? Trash!”

They say if fists can solve it, there’s no need to talk—punching Mu Hongtu felt amazing.

Mu Hongtu, Mu Zhenguo, and He Cuifang all looked stunned. They had tried to hide this from Mu Lantu but didn’t expect he’d still find out.

Mu Hongtu held his face, wide-eyed in disbelief that Mu Lantu actually hit him.

“Who told you that? It’s not true at all! You’d rather believe outsiders than your own brother?”

Mu Lantu grabbed his collar and landed another punch to the stomach.

“Oh yeah? Then why is everyone at Hongke Restaurant talking about it? Want me to bring in witnesses?”

Mu Hongtu’s expression changed again. He’d thought Yang Xiurong only said it at home. Did she also say it at the restaurant? Then he remembered—He Cuifang and Yang Xiurong had gotten into a fight at work and lost their jobs. Was that because she’d said Mu Lantu was being kept?

He looked uncertainly at He Cuifang.

Her gaze held both pain and resentment.

“Hongtu, you had no reason to call your brother back. No matter why Yang Xiurong wants a divorce, it has nothing to do with him. It’s his money—he can spend it however he wants! You’ve been out in the world so long and still don’t get that?”

Mu Hongtu remained resentful. “You and Dad always favored him!”

Mu Zhenguo was furious.

“How did we favor him? Let’s be honest—you’re just jealous he’s doing better than you! We told you to stay in school, but you insisted on dropping out. You wanted to marry Yang Xiurong early—we tried to stop you. I said there’s no future in operating excavators and urged you to learn a trade—cooking, auto repair, anything! Did you listen? You chose your own path, and now you blame others?”

Mu Hongtu didn’t listen, eyes fixed on Mu Lantu.

“She said unless you give her 300,000 yuan, she won’t divorce me. If she divorces me, she’ll take Xuanyuan and Xiao Yu with her. They’re your niece and nephew. Can you really bear that?”

“If their own parents can, why wouldn’t I, their uncle, be able to?” Mu Lantu took the wet wipes Xu Huazhang handed him, cleaned his hands, and sat back down. “I came back for two things. First—I no longer acknowledge Mu Hongtu as my brother. Whether he divorces or not is none of my business. From now on, Yang Xiurong is a stranger to me.”

Not just Mu Hongtu—both parents were shocked.

“Lantu, you…”

Mu Zhenguo and He Cuifang clearly didn’t agree.

“I’ve made up my mind,” Mu Lantu said firmly. “Dad, Mom, after all they’ve said about me, do you really want to try persuading me? Because if you do, that means I can say whatever I want about them in the future, right? If you agree with that, I’ll take back what I said.”
